Subject: | Wine Expanded Permits Eligibility |
Soon, I will be introducing legislation to allow beer distributors to be eligible for wine expanded permits. As many of you are aware, in 2016, the General Assembly enacted legislation to provide customers with greater convenience when they purchase wine. Act 39 of that year allowed private retailers who possess a restaurant (R) or hotel (H) liquor license to obtain a Wine Expanded Permit to sell up 3,000ml of wine for off-premises consumption. Notably, the legislation did not allow beer distributors to be eligible to receive this permit. After the success of Act 39, I believe now is the time to expand the number of outlets who can sell wine for off-premise consumption, while providing beer distributors with an option to remain competitive in a changed liquor marketplace. |
Introduced as HB2218
